Originally Posted by Ken167
What brand LED bulb did you get and from where I want to replace the HID bulbs too. Did you use a decoder for anti-flicker?
I'm currently on my third 2IS as well as a CT200h, I've always replaced the halogen bulbs with LEDs. I've never bought a specific brand, but steer clear from LED with the multiple SMDs (not bright enough for driving visibility) and fans (break causing light failure). To replace halogen it is plug and play. I know there a few new styles that have multiple brightnesses, this might (no idea) work to not need a resistor on the DRL/high beam - the issue is the DRL bulb on the older style headlamp is the high beam at 30% so it strobes due to lack of power or is at full high beam brightness. On my 2006, I just always left the lights on and it solved that issue.

All that said, if you have HID, keep them. They have much better light output, without question.
